Oyo Poll: PDP Emerges Victory in 33 LG Seats

The ruling Peoples Democratic Party in Oyo State has successfully won all the chairmanship seats in the 33 local government areas of the state.

The local government election was conducted on Saturday by the Oyo State Independent Electoral Commission.

The OYSIEC, Isiaka Olagunju (SAN), who announced the results of the poll on Sunday at the OYSIEC’s secretariat in Ibadan, said the PDP won in all 33 LGs.

Olagunju, who expressed his gratitude to those who contributed to the successful outcome of the election, said: “Of course, we are not perfect. There are areas of improvement. Anyhow, we promise you that it will reflect in our report to the government. If he hasn’t shown commitment and dedication and support, we wouldn’t be where we are.”

Also speaking shortly the official declaration of the result, the Ibadan North-East Chairman-elect, Akintayo Akinsola, affirmed that “The election was really peaceful, it was free, fair and credible.

The official election results declared by OYSIEC showed that the PDP polled 66,325 votes at Akinyele Local Government Area while the All Progressives Congress recorded 3,477 votes.

Details of the poll

The PDP won the North-East Local Government Area chairmanship with 17,920  while At Ibadan South-East Local Government Area, the PDP won the election, having polled 22, 220 votes while the APC received 4, 265 votes.

The PDP also won the chairmanship of Ibadan North Local Government Area with 73, 240 votes, with the APC coming behind with 5,548 votes.

The chairmanship of Lagelu Local Government Area was clinched by the PDP with 65, 786 votes , while the APC polled 4,172 votes. Also, Akeem Olatunji won the chairmanship of Oluyole Local Government Area with 17,063 votes while APC received 3,536 votes.

Also, the PDP received 25, 702 votes to win the chairmanship in Ibadan South-West Local Government Area, while the APC polled 5,978 votes.

At Orire Local Government Area, the PDP emerged as the chairmanship winner with 15,301 votes, and the APC received 5,579 votes.
